STM32F051K4 是意法半导体(STMicroelectronics)推出的一款基于ARM Cortex-M0内核的32位微控制器。它属于STM32F0系列,专为需要高性能、低功耗和高集成度的应用设计。该芯片采用LQFP32封装,具备丰富的外设接口和灵活的时钟配置,适用于工业控制、消费电子、智能传感器等多种应用场景。
内核:ARM Cortex-M0
主频:最高48 MHz
Flash容量:16 KB
SRAM容量:2 KB
封装类型:LQFP32
工作电压:2.4V ~ 3.6V
工作温度范围:-40°C ~ +85°C
ADC:12位,最多16通道
定时器:多个16位和32位定时器
通信接口:I2C、SPI、USART、CAN
STM32F051K4 具备一系列高性能特性,使其在嵌入式系统中表现出色。首先,该芯片搭载了ARM Cortex-M0内核,提供高效的32位运算能力,适用于复杂的控制算法和实时任务处理。其最高主频可达48 MHz,确保了快速的数据处理能力。
在存储方面,STM32F051K4 提供了16 KB的Flash存储器和2 KB的SRAM,足以支持大多数中小型嵌入式应用。Flash存储器支持多次擦写,适合频繁更新程序的应用场景。同时,其SRAM容量足以满足实时数据处理的需求。
该芯片采用LQFP32封装,具备良好的封装兼容性和PCB布局灵活性,便于在各种设计中使用。其工作电压范围为2.4V至3.6V,适用于多种电源管理方案,包括电池供电设备。此外,其工作温度范围为-40°C至+85°C,适应工业级环境要求,适合在恶劣环境下稳定运行。
STM32F051K4 集成了丰富的外设接口,包括多个定时器、ADC、DAC、SPI、I2C和USART等模块。其中,12位ADC最多支持16个通道,适用于高精度模拟信号采集;多个定时器支持PWM输出、输入捕获等功能,适用于电机控制、传感器信号处理等应用场景。此外,其通信接口支持多种标准协议,如I2C用于连接传感器和EEPROM,SPI用于高速数据传输,USART支持串口通信,CAN接口适用于工业现场总线通信。
低功耗是该芯片的一大亮点,STM32F051K4 提供多种低功耗模式,包括待机、停机和睡眠模式,帮助设计者优化系统功耗,延长电池寿命。此外,其内置的时钟控制系统允许用户根据应用需求动态调整主频,从而在性能与功耗之间取得最佳平衡。
最后,STM32F051K4 还具备良好的开发支持。ST官方提供了丰富的开发工具,如STM32CubeMX、STM32CubeIDE和ST-Link调试器,帮助开发者快速上手和调试。此外,社区和官方文档资源丰富,为开发者提供了强有力的技术支持。
STM32F051K4 适用于多种嵌入式应用场景,包括但不限于工业自动化、智能传感器、家电控制、楼宇自动化、医疗设备和消费电子产品。在工业自动化领域,该芯片可以作为PLC控制器或传感器节点,用于数据采集和控制任务;在智能家居系统中,它可以用于温控器、照明控制器或安全系统;在医疗设备中,可用于便携式监护仪或智能药泵;在消费电子领域,可应用于智能手环、穿戴设备或智能玩具等产品。其丰富的外设接口和低功耗特性,也使其成为物联网(IoT)设备的理想选择,如无线传感器节点、远程监控设备等。
STM32F051K6, STM32F030K6, STM32F070K6